RCU Contributes Over $24,000 through Tri-County Human Race Events
SANTA ROSA, CA (May 13, 2014) -- Three teams of employees from Redwood Credit Union (RCU) recently participated in Human Race events held in Sonoma, Marin and Mendocino counties. A total of 130 volunteers from RCU, including employees, family and friends walked or ran in the races, raising funds for a variety of local nonprofits. In addition to voluntary support and the Credit Union’s corporate sponsorships, RCU staff collected monetary pledges and donations, bringing RCU’s collective contributions to over $24,000.
Sponsored by local volunteer centers, the Human Race invites participants to collect pledges and walk or run a 3K or 10K course to raise money for the local nonprofit of their choice. RCU's Ukiah Branch raised/donated $5,000 to the Mendocino County Human Race, which resulted in the RCU team being recognized as the highest fundraising team for the event.

About Redwood Credit Union
Founded in 1950, Redwood Credit Union is a full-service financial institution providing personal and business banking to anyone living or working in the North Bay or San Francisco. As a financial cooperative focused on people not profit, RCU offers complete financial services including checking and savings accounts, auto and home loans, credit cards, online and mobile banking, business services, commercial and SBA lending, investment and financial planning services and more. The Credit Union also offers a variety of insurance products and discount auto sales through their wholly-owned subsidiary. RCU currently has more than $2.3 billion in assets and serves over 232,000 Members with 18 full-service branch locations from San Francisco to Ukiah, more than 30,000 fee-free network ATMs nationwide and convenient, free online and mobile banking.
